Discovering the Charm of Godshill Cider Company
Godshill Cider Company is a delightful gem nestled in the heart of the Isle of Wight, offering visitors a taste of authentic English cider crafted with passion and precision. Established with a commitment to quality, this family-run cider house has become a beloved destination for both locals and tourists alike. The company prides itself on using traditional methods, combined with modern techniques, to produce a variety of ciders that are truly unique to the region. What sets Godshill Cider apart is its dedication to sourcing local ingredients, ensuring that every bottle reflects the rich agricultural heritage of the Isle of Wight.
Visitors can immerse themselves in the cider-making process, learning about the careful selection of apples that are harvested at their peak ripeness. The fermentation process is an art form in itself, with each batch undergoing careful monitoring to achieve the perfect balance of flavor and aroma. Whether you prefer a crisp, dry cider or a sweeter option, Godshill Cider Company has something to satisfy every palate. The range of ciders available includes traditional favorites as well as innovative blends that highlight the unique characteristics of local apple varieties.
As you explore the charming grounds of the cider company, you'll find that the atmosphere is as inviting as the products themselves. The rustic buildings and picturesque orchards create a serene setting, perfect for enjoying a refreshing cider on a sunny day. With a focus on sustainability and environmental responsibility, Godshill Cider Company is not only dedicated to producing high-quality cider but also to preserving the beautiful landscape of the Isle of Wight for future generations.

Exploring Local Attractions Around Godshill Cider Company
The area surrounding Godshill Cider Company is rich in attractions that enhance your visit to the Isle of Wight. Just a short drive away, you’ll find the charming village of Godshill itself, known for its picturesque streets, quaint shops, and beautiful church. The historic Godshill Church, with its stunning architecture and serene gardens, is a must-visit for those interested in local history and culture.
For a taste of nature, head to the nearby Shanklin Chine, a beautiful gorge that offers stunning views and lovely walking paths. This natural wonder is perfect for a leisurely stroll, allowing visitors to immerse themselves in the lush surroundings. The Chine is home to a variety of wildlife and plants, making it a great spot for nature enthusiasts and photographers alike.
If you're interested in history, don't miss the Isle of Wight Zoo, which is not only a fun family outing but also focuses on conservation efforts. The zoo is home to a range of animals, including big cats and reptiles, and offers educational experiences for visitors of all ages. Exploring these local attractions will ensure a well-rounded trip, complementing the delightful experience of cider tasting at Godshill Cider Company.

Dining Options Near Godshill Cider Company
After a delightful day of cider tasting, satisfying your appetite is a must. The area surrounding Godshill Cider Company boasts a variety of dining options that cater to different tastes and budgets. For a casual dining experience, The Old Smithy Inn is a charming pub that serves hearty meals made from locally sourced ingredients. Their menu features classic British dishes, including fish and chips, burgers, and vegetarian options, making it a great stop for families and friends.
If you’re in the mood for something a bit more upscale, The Garlic Farm Restaurant is a must-visit. Located not far from Godshill, this restaurant specializes in dishes that highlight the region’s garlic production. The menu features an array of seasonal dishes, and the ambiance is perfect for a romantic dinner or a special celebration. Pair your meal with a glass of cider from Godshill Cider Company for the ultimate local dining experience.
For those who prefer a quick bite or something sweet, local cafés and bakeries offer delicious pastries and snacks. Godshill Tea Gardens is a quaint spot to enjoy a traditional English cream tea, complete with scones, clotted cream, and jam. With so many dining options available, visitors are sure to find something to satisfy their cravings after a day of cider exploration.

Nature Walks and Scenic Views Near Godshill Cider Company
Nature enthusiasts will find plenty to explore around Godshill Cider Company, with an array of scenic walks and breathtaking views. The Isle of Wight is renowned for its natural beauty, offering diverse landscapes that range from lush woodlands to stunning coastal cliffs. One popular walking route is the Godshill to Shanklin Coastal Path, which provides stunning views of the coastline and the opportunity to spot local wildlife along the way.
The Chine at Shanklin is another beautiful area to explore, featuring a picturesque gorge filled with lush vegetation and charming waterfalls. The walking paths are well-maintained, making it suitable for all ages and fitness levels. Nature lovers can also enjoy birdwatching and photography opportunities, capturing the beauty of the Isle of Wight’s diverse flora and fauna.
For those seeking a more challenging hike, the Needles Headland and Tennyson Down offers breathtaking views of the iconic Needles rock formation and the English Channel. The trails here are well-marked, and the panoramic views from the top are absolutely worth the effort. Whether you’re looking for a leisurely stroll or a more adventurous hike, the nature walks near Godshill Cider Company provide the perfect way to experience the island’s stunning landscapes.
